US Senate Committee to Vote on Bill Targeting Chinese Vehicles

According to Reuters, a US Senate committee is preparing to vote on a bill aimed at increasing restrictions on vehicles of Chinese origin. The bill seeks to limit the entry of electric vehicles and related technologies manufactured in China into the US market, citing national security concerns. The vote is seen as a measure against the growing presence of Chinese automakers in the US. If passed, the bill is expected to impose additional scrutiny on vehicles made in China, as well as the software and hardware components used in them. This development could create a potential competitive advantage for domestic US automakers and suppliers. However, restricting Chinese manufacturers' access to the US market could disrupt global supply chains and affect consumer prices. If the bill passes the Senate, it will need to go through a similar process in the House of Representatives. Analysts warn that such regulations could trigger a new wave of tensions in US-China trade relations. This is not investment advice.
